Saturday and Sunday Syllabus
Let’s get to work to understand how to build prefabricated 100% Hands-On!
- Learn how-to build a floor joist system hands-on (this can be prefabricated as well).
- Building walls hands-on which can fit into a standard 4×8 utility trailer for transport to your building site if you are doing a prefabricated build at home.
- Learn how-to Build a door and window wall hands-on. Design and build lintels (header beams) will be explored hands-on, including proper sizing etc.
- How you can find a rich resource of reclaimed building materials for your build. Including windows and doors.
- Learn how to erect the floor platform on the foundation hands-on. Then how to erect the walls, learn how to brace and install hands-on.
- Learn how-to erect the roof (this can be prefabricated as well) with a hands-on discussion on rafters, roof beams, collar ties and ceiling joists.
- Discussion on exterior finishes and interior finishes.

About your instructor Dr. Christopher Cooper
Dr. Cooper is a pioneer in the design and construction of so-called tiny houses designing and building prefabricated house kits for the Japanese market (some as small as 400 sq.ft.) since the early 1980’s. Miniaturizing our ideals of how we should live is very important, all the while making sure that clever ideas are created for storage and efficiency. Do you have a dream to homestead? Do you want a cottage, backyard studio, addition, roadside stand or shed? Christopher is well aware of all of the restrictions of building small in the Maritimes.
